Re: [PATCH v2] checkpatch: look for common misspellings

From: Kees Cook
Date: Thu Sep 11 2014 - 10:12:32 EST


On Thu, Sep 11, 2014 at 12:19 AM, Geert Uytterhoeven
<geert@xxxxxxxxxxxxxx> wrote:
> On Thu, Sep 11, 2014 at 12:52 AM, Andrew Morton
> <akpm@xxxxxxxxxxxxxxxxxxxx> wrote:
>> On Mon, 8 Sep 2014 11:15:24 -0700 Kees Cook <keescook@xxxxxxxxxxxx> wrote:
>>
>>> Check for misspellings, based on Debian's lintian list. Several false
>>> positives were removed, and several additional words added that were
>>> common in the kernel:
>>>
>>> backword backwords
>>> invalide valide
>>> recieves
>>> singed unsinged
>>>
>>> While going back and fixing existing spelling mistakes isn't a high
>>> priority, it'd be nice to try to catch them before they hit the tree.
>>
>> I have a feeling this is going to be a rat hole and that
>> scripts/spelling.txt will grow to consume the planet. Oh well, whatev.
>
> What about making checkpatch use the codespell dictionay if codespell
> is installed?
>
> Codespell is in Ubuntu 14.04LTS (but not in 12.04LTS).

It's probably not a bad idea, but given the level of pruning that's
been needed already to keep down the false positive rate, I'm nervous
about a larger "general" corpus.

-Kees

--
Kees Cook
Chrome OS Security
--
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to majordomo@xxxxxxxxxxxxxxx
More majordomo info at http://vger.kernel.org/majordomo-info.html
Please read the FAQ at http://www.tux.org/lkml/